1. Quality Materials
The longevity and performance of canopies in Singapore’s demanding tropical climate are directly linked to the quality of materials used in their construction. High-quality fabrics, such as solution-dyed acrylics or PVC-coated polyester, offer superior resistance to UV degradation, mildew, and water damage. These materials maintain their color and structural integrity over extended periods, even with frequent exposure to intense sunlight and heavy rainfall. Similarly, robust framework materials like aluminum or galvanized steel provide essential strength and stability, ensuring the canopy can withstand strong winds and other environmental stresses. Choosing a supplier prioritizing these high-quality materials represents a crucial investment in long-term durability and performance.
Consider a scenario where two canopies are installed side-by-side: one made with lower-grade materials and the other with premium-quality components. Over time, the lower-grade canopy might exhibit signs of fading, tearing, or rusting, requiring frequent repairs or even replacement. The premium canopy, however, would likely remain in excellent condition, providing consistent shade and protection with minimal maintenance. This difference highlights the significant long-term cost savings and reduced inconvenience associated with investing in quality materials upfront.
Understanding the importance of material quality empowers informed decision-making when selecting a canopy supplier in Singapore. By prioritizing suppliers committed to using durable, weather-resistant materials, businesses can ensure their canopies provide reliable performance and aesthetic appeal for years to come. This ultimately minimizes lifecycle costs and maximizes the return on investment.
2. Design Expertise
A canopy supplier’s design expertise is fundamental to ensuring a functional and aesthetically pleasing outdoor space in Singapore. Effective design considers factors like site-specific requirements, intended use, prevailing weather conditions, and surrounding architecture. A skilled supplier translates these considerations into a canopy solution that optimizes shade, ventilation, and rainwater management while complementing the overall aesthetics of the location.
-
Site Assessment and Customization:
Accurate site assessment forms the foundation of effective canopy design. This involves evaluating the area’s dimensions, topography, existing structures, and potential obstructions. A supplier with strong design expertise uses this information to create custom-tailored canopy solutions that maximize coverage and functionality while integrating seamlessly with the surrounding environment. For instance, a canopy designed for a sloped area might incorporate specialized drainage systems to prevent water accumulation. Similarly, canopies intended for commercial spaces might integrate branding elements or lighting features.
-
Structural Integrity and Wind Resistance:
Singapore’s susceptibility to strong winds necessitates careful consideration of structural integrity in canopy design. Experienced suppliers employ engineering principles and advanced modeling techniques to ensure canopies can withstand high wind loads. This involves selecting appropriate materials, calculating stress points, and optimizing structural design for maximum stability. A robust design safeguards against potential damage and ensures the canopy remains secure even during adverse weather conditions. For example, reinforced frames and strategically placed supports can significantly enhance a canopy’s wind resistance.
-
Aesthetics and Integration:
Beyond functionality, a well-designed canopy enhances the visual appeal of a space. Design expertise encompasses the ability to create aesthetically pleasing structures that complement existing architecture and landscaping. This might involve selecting appropriate colors, shapes, and materials to achieve a harmonious integration with the surroundings. For a historic building, a canopy design might incorporate traditional architectural elements, while a modern setting might benefit from a sleek, minimalist design.
-
Compliance with Regulations:
Navigating local building codes and regulations is essential for any canopy installation in Singapore. A reputable supplier possesses in-depth knowledge of these requirements and ensures all designs comply with relevant safety and construction standards. This includes obtaining necessary permits and adhering to specific guidelines regarding materials, dimensions, and installation procedures. Demonstrating compliance safeguards against potential legal issues and ensures the project proceeds smoothly.
By prioritizing these facets of design expertise, businesses can select a canopy supplier in Singapore capable of delivering not just a functional shade structure but also a valuable asset that enhances the overall aesthetic and value of their property. A well-designed canopy seamlessly integrates with its surroundings, provides reliable protection from the elements, and contributes to a more comfortable and inviting outdoor environment.
3. Reliable Installation
Reliable installation is a critical aspect differentiating reputable canopy suppliers in Singapore. A properly installed canopy ensures structural integrity, safety, and optimal performance. Conversely, faulty installation can lead to a range of problems, including premature wear and tear, structural instability, and potential safety hazards. The connection between reliable installation and a reputable supplier lies in the supplier’s commitment to employing trained and experienced installation teams, utilizing appropriate equipment, and adhering to strict safety protocols.
Consider a scenario where a large retractable canopy is installed incorrectly. Improper anchoring or inadequate tensioning can cause the canopy to malfunction, potentially collapsing during strong winds or heavy rain. This not only damages the canopy itself but also poses a significant risk to individuals and property beneath. A reputable supplier mitigates such risks by ensuring their installation teams possess the necessary skills and experience to handle various canopy types and installation challenges. They invest in appropriate tools and equipment, follow established safety procedures, and conduct thorough quality checks after installation to guarantee optimal performance and safety. For example, using calibrated tensioning devices and ensuring proper anchoring into suitable substrates are crucial steps in a reliable installation process.
Choosing a canopy supplier in Singapore based solely on price without considering installation expertise can lead to significant long-term costs and safety concerns. Reliable installation represents an investment in the longevity and safety of the canopy structure. Reputable suppliers understand this crucial connection and prioritize professional installation as an integral part of their service offering. This commitment to quality installation translates into a secure, functional, and durable canopy that provides reliable performance for years to come, ultimately minimizing risks and maximizing the return on investment.

5. After-sales Service
Within the context of canopy supply in Singapore, after-sales service represents a critical component distinguishing reputable suppliers from less reliable alternatives. This service encompasses a range of support activities provided after the initial purchase and installation, significantly impacting the long-term performance, lifespan, and overall value of the canopy investment. Effective after-sales service demonstrates a supplier’s commitment to customer satisfaction and builds long-term relationships. A comprehensive after-sales program might include warranty coverage for materials and workmanship, preventative maintenance schedules, prompt response to repair requests, and readily available replacement parts. This proactive approach minimizes downtime, extends the canopy’s lifespan, and reinforces customer confidence in the supplier’s reliability. For example, a supplier offering regular maintenance visits can identify and address minor issues before they escalate into major problems, potentially saving significant costs and disruptions in the long run.
The practical significance of robust after-sales service becomes particularly evident in Singapore’s challenging climate. Frequent exposure to intense sunlight, heavy rainfall, and strong winds can accelerate wear and tear on canopy components. A supplier committed to after-sales service provides timely repairs, replacement parts, and expert advice on maintenance practices, mitigating the impact of these environmental factors and ensuring the canopy remains functional and aesthetically pleasing. Consider a scenario where a canopy’s fabric tears due to strong winds. A supplier with efficient after-sales service would promptly assess the damage, provide a replacement fabric section, and carry out the necessary repairs, minimizing disruption to the business or property owner. Conversely, a lack of responsive after-sales support could result in prolonged downtime, costly repairs, and potential safety hazards.
Selecting a canopy supplier in Singapore based solely on initial cost without considering the scope and quality of after-sales service presents significant risks. Comprehensive after-sales support directly contributes to the long-term value and performance of the canopy investment. Reputable suppliers recognize this connection and invest in robust after-sales programs, offering clients peace of mind and ensuring the continued functionality and longevity of their canopy solutions. This commitment to long-term customer satisfaction ultimately minimizes lifecycle costs, maximizes return on investment, and fosters strong, enduring relationships between suppliers and clients.

Question 1: What materials are most suitable for canopies in Singapore’s climate?
Solution-dyed acrylics and PVC-coated polyester fabrics offer excellent resistance to UV degradation, mildew, and water damage, making them ideal for Singapore’s tropical climate. For framework materials, aluminum and galvanized steel provide the necessary strength and corrosion resistance.
Question 2: How long does it take to install a canopy?
Installation time varies depending on the canopy’s size, complexity, and site conditions. Simple installations might take a few days, while more complex projects could require several weeks. A reputable supplier provides accurate time estimates after conducting a thorough site assessment.
Question 3: What maintenance is required for a canopy?
Regular cleaning with mild detergent and water helps maintain the canopy’s appearance and prolong its lifespan. Periodic inspections for damage, such as tears in the fabric or corrosion on the framework, are also recommended. Professional maintenance services can address more complex issues.
Question 4: What warranties are typically offered on canopies?
Warranties typically cover defects in materials and workmanship, ranging from one to several years. Specific warranty terms vary depending on the supplier and the materials used. It’s essential to clarify warranty details before making a purchase.
